The 2024 Ontario Sunshine List shows that the average and median salaries for a Child Mental Health Lead are $151,217.20 and $129,654.51, respectively.
In 2024, Louise Gallagher, holding the position of Chief, Child And Mental Health at the The Hospital for Sick Children received the highest salary of $390,905.28 among similar positions in Ontario public organizations. Emma Thompson, serving as the Child Mental Health Lead at County of Renfrew , earned the highest salary of $102,882.69 among individuals in the same position across public organizations in Ontario during that year.
In the year 2024, the highest-paying organizations for Child Mental Health Lead and similar positions in the Ontario were as follows: The Hospital for Sick Children with an average pay of $390,905.28; Joseph Brant Hospital with an average pay of $175,372.48; Kinark Child and Family Services with an average pay of $156,994.50; Cornwall Community Hospital with an average pay of $143,132.82; and Thunder Bay Regional Health Sciences Centre with an average pay of $142,176.21.
A total of 10 organizations had employees who held comparable positions as mentioned in the Ontario Sunshine list.
In the year 2024, the highest-paying sector or industries for Child Mental Health Lead and similar positions in the Ontario were as follows: Hospitals and Boards of Public Health with an average pay of $187,236.25; Other Public Sector Employers with an average pay of $130,244.74; and Municipalities and Services with an average pay of $102,882.69.
There were 3 sectors where employees held similar positions, as indicated in the Ontario Sunshine list.
The 2024 Ontario Sunshine List indicates that the representation of gender diversity in Child Mental Health Lead is 20.00% male and 80.00% female, respectively.
